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ges by seniority for Range Of Benefits roles?
Entry‑level Benefits Coordinators earn $48k–$65k annually, mid‑level Analysts and Administrators range $65k–$90k, and senior Managers or Directors command $90k–$125k, often with bonus or equity tied to benefit‑cost savings.
Which skills and certifications are essential for this field?
Proficiency in benefit administration platforms such as Workday, ADP, Gusto, or Ceridian is mandatory. Certifications like Certified Employee Benefits Specialist (CEBS), SHRM‑CP, or SAP SuccessFactors Associate validate expertise and open higher‑level roles.
Can Range Of Benefits positions be performed remotely?
Yes, many employers support fully remote or hybrid setups for Benefits Analysts and Coordinators, leveraging cloud‑based platforms and secure VPNs to manage enrollment, data analytics, and vendor communication from anywhere.
What career progression paths exist within Range Of Benefits?
Typical progression starts with Benefits Coordinator → Benefits Analyst → Benefits Manager → Benefits Director → HR Director or Chief Benefits Officer, each step adding scope over strategy, budgeting, and cross‑functional collaboration.
What industry trends are shaping Range Of Benefits roles today?
Trends focus on holistic wellness, mental‑health coverage, gig‑worker benefits, and flexible spending accounts. Employers prioritize data‑driven benefit optimization, AI‑enabled enrollment tools, and remote‑first benefit packages to retain talent.
